Media notes
NOTES: (General Climate: Humid. Cover Density: Thick. Bias: II.) Subspecies is leucogaster. Description at end of cut. Shrub later identified as Vernonia sp. Evidently a roost for the Hemispingus Came through the thickets every day at same time and sang over the thickets just after dawn. See other cuts. Normally this species foraged high in trees. Recording began with the individual about 15 m. away and continued to about 1 m away with recording level turned down as it approached. Habitat: Second-growth, Edge.
